Nintendo Direct Reveals New Games Ahead Of Switch 2 Launch

Fans eagerly await details on the upcoming Nintendo Switch 2 console set to be unveiled on April 2, 2025.

Nintendo fans are buzzing with excitement as the company gears up for the upcoming Nintendo Switch 2 console reveal, scheduled for April 2, 2025. Just a week before this highly anticipated event, Nintendo held a Nintendo Direct live stream on March 27, 2025, focusing on new game announcements for the original Switch.

The March 27 presentation, which ran for approximately 36 minutes, showcased a slate of new titles and updates, including a mix of first-party and third-party games. Notable announcements included the Dragon Quest I & II HD-2D Remake, set to launch later this year, and the narrative-driven detective game No Sleep For Kaname Date, which is scheduled for a July 25 release exclusively on Nintendo Switch.

Among the highlights was a gameplay trailer for Metroid Prime 4: Beyond, which is still listed for a 2025 release. In this new installment, players will control Samus Aran as she explores a lush alien world and gains psychic abilities that allow her to manipulate her environment. The trailer hinted at exciting gameplay mechanics but did not provide a specific release date.

One of the more surprising announcements was for the Disney Villains Cursed Café, which is available for download immediately following the presentation. This game allows players to take on the role of a café owner serving potions to iconic Disney villains, adding a mischievous twist to the gameplay.

Other titles announced during the Direct included Patapon 1+2 Replay, launching on July 11, and the cozy farming simulation game Story of Seasons: Grand Bazaar, set for an August 27 release. Additionally, the virtual game card feature was introduced, allowing players to lend and borrow digital games between Nintendo Switch systems, which is expected to roll out with a system update in late April 2025.

Fans were also treated to a look at Pokémon Legends: Z-A, which is scheduled for release in late 2025. This game will feature a day/night cycle and special tournaments that players can participate in as they navigate the bustling Lumiose City.

While the March 27 Direct was focused solely on the original Nintendo Switch, excitement is building for the next Direct, where more details about the Switch 2 will be unveiled. Nintendo has confirmed that this event will take place at 6 a.m. PT on April 2, 2025. Expectations are high for announcements regarding the console's specifications, potential launch titles, and whether it will support 4K graphics when docked.
